Step by Step Tips To Add Audio To Your Blog

How to create an Audio casting - Podcast? What you really need is just a recording software + microphone+your computer! In this article, I will introduce to you some easy ways to create your own podcast, and it is very easy!

Some of the software tools that you need:

Tool #1 - Sound / Audio Recording Program - Highly recommended - Audacity. This is a very easy to use software and the best part - It's FREE! You can easily edit, change the playing speed, volume and adding file on your audio.

Tool #2 - Microphone - Any microphone or webcam with microphone will do! The recorded sound should be clear, try not to use low quality microphone, it is not worth turning away your audience to save few bucks!

Tool #3 - Use Podpress plugin for your blog - An audio plugin that allows Wordpress blog to play audio file. Unfortunately it does not support blogger and typepad blog, you need to find an audio service that provide some kind of JavaScript for integration.

One of the greatest benefit of using podcast is make your visitor stay at your blog as long as possible, giving more "quality" feel to the search engine that your blog is really good. After recorded and edited your speech, you can just upload it to the server, preferably on the wp-content/uploads of your blog.

If you want to do an Interview podcast, you need to Install skype on both Interviewee and Interviewer's computer! Start recording when you are in the conversation, that's all…

The key to make your own podcast is not how, but rather what content you are offering, a podcast that too long will bore your audience. What you need is keeping them shot and sweet, at the same time providing interesting information that will is enough to get your audience attention and continue to visit your post frequently.
